TWO Priory Community School pupils are kicking their way to the top of their game.

Jake Caulfield, of Market Avenue in St Georges and Joe Gadd, who lives in Upper Bristol Road in Weston, both aged 14, have been selected to play rugby for The Bristol Academy.

School principal Neville Coles said: "Both Jake and Joe are exceptional rugby players.

"However, what has really pleased us about their selections is the way in which they have been commended on their attitude and sportsmanship.

"This is fantastic for the parents, school, PE department and our local rugby clubs who have clearly instilled in these fine young men a real sense of being confident and responsible individuals, with a real sense of 'fair play'.

"When I spoke to The Bristol Academy director he said that he suspected as much and could see what fine representatives for Priory Community School and Weston these young men would be."

The Bristol Rugby Academy was established in 1999. It has produced one of the most dominant rugby teams in the UK in the form of the under 21s team, which won the league for three consecutive years. The under 19s also made it through to the national cup final.
